Green Solutions for the Modern Office
In today's ever-evolving business world, companies are increasingly seeking innovative ways to minimize their environmental impact. The modern office, often a hub of activity and resource consumption, presents both challenges and opportunities for sustainability. Implementing green solutions can not only reduce the office's carbon footprint but also enhance employee well-being and boost brand image.
- Explore energy-saving practices such as utilizing natural light, investing in energy-efficient lighting, and promoting the use of smart thermostats.
- Adopt sustainable office supplies, including recycled paper, refillable ink cartridges, and reusable containers.
- Encourage a culture of recycling and waste reduction through designated bins for diverse materials and composting programs.
With these and other sustainable practices, offices can create a healthier, more sustainable work environment for employees website and contribute to a more sustainable future.
Building a Collaborative Workspace for the Digital Age
In today's dynamic landscape, cultivating an engaging collaborative workspace is paramount for teams to excel. A well-designed space empowers team individuals to collaborate seamlessly, fostering a culture of innovation. By integrating cutting-edge technologies and embracing innovative design principles, teams can revamp their workspaces into vibrant hubs of collaboration.
Essential considerations when developing a collaborative workspace in the digital age is ensuring reliable and high-speed connectivity. This enables real-time communication, seamless file sharing, and access to cloud-based resources.
Furthermore, a diverse range of settings is crucial to meet the needs of different work styles. Open areas encourage spontaneous brainstorming and team interactions, while private spaces provide a conducive environment for focused work.
Prioritizing ergonomic furniture, proper lighting, and comfortable temperature adjustments contribute to a welcoming workspace where improves employee comfort. Finally, incorporating elements of nature, such as plants or natural light, can promote a sense of calm.
Embracing the Desk: Adaptive Furniture for Flexible Offices
The modern workplace is in a state of rapid evolution, with flexibility and adaptability becoming key factors. With this shift, traditional office furniture is no longer enough. Adaptive furniture takes center stage as a solution to the growing demand for versatile workspaces. This type of furniture enables employees to easily transition between diverse work styles, from focused individual tasks to collaborative brainstorms.
- Adjustable desks can lower to suit different positions, promoting better posture.
- Interchangeable furniture components allow employees to customize their workspaces to enhance productivity and comfort.
- Collaborative areas can be quickly adjusted to facilitate team interactions and brainstorming meetings.
Through embracing adaptive furniture, companies can foster a more dynamic work environment that encourages employee comfort and performance.
